Yorgan Edem Agblemagnon (born 9 July 1999) is a footballer who plays as a goalkeeper for French club US Châteauneuf-sur-Loire and the Togo national team.

International career[]

Agblemagnon was born in France, the son of former Togolese goalkeeper Guy Agblemagnon.[1] He debuted for the Togo national team in a friendly 0–0 tie with Libya on 24 March 2017.[2][3]
